Bonnie Kail Heads Sales at Platinum X Pictures

Bonnie Kail, one of the top sales professionals in adult entertainment, told AVN.com Tuesday she is leaving her position at Heatwave Entertainment for a similar role at the newly launched Platinum X Pictures.

Kail handled all the domestic sales for Heatwave for the past five years. She will make the move to Platinum X, which is co-owned by Michael Stefano, Jewel De'Nyle, Manuel Ferrara, Brandon Iron and Steve Holmes, on March 10.

"The role will be basically handling all the sales and marketing, beyond that, I don't know. Whatever they need me to do, I'll be doing. It's the ground floor. I feel good about it. Mike has a great reputation," Kail said.

"... It's always difficult to leave any place. You become like family. I already told (Heatwave) I'll do whatever it takes to make the transition work for both of us. I adore them. But I'm very excited to be starting something from the ground up. This is very good for me professionally."

Kail's career in adult has spanned nearly 20 years. She got her start with Caballero Video selling films to mom & pop stores before she took an opportunity at Las Vegas Video and remained there for the next 10 years.

One of the people she met along the way was Red Light District co-owner Dion Giarrusso, who is a consultant for Platinum X and helped make the connection happen.

"I'm acting as a consultant to Platinum X Pictures and part of my job is getting the right people to do sales and shipping and other stuff," Giarrusso told AVN.com. "A lot of people don't know the value of treating this like a business and it is a business. You could have the greatest directors and the greatest talent and boxes, but if you don't have the right person selling, I don't think you can make it.

"She has relationships. It's a saturated market. ... They need someone who can get you in the door."

Giarrusso added, "Michael Stefano is a good friend and Brandon: I like him, having worked with him over here. I'm going to do whatever I can to help them."

Kail said she was "flattered" that Giarrusso considered her in that regard.

"I was grateful that he thought enough of me to put us together. I have a lot of respect for Dion," she said. "How many people in the course of a year can build up something that fast?"

Stefano told AVN.com Tuesday that his company will release its first title, I Love It Rough, on April 1, followed by Teens Revealed on April 15. And starting in May, Platinum will hit the streets with one title a week.

"I hear nothing but great things about Bonnie Kail," Stefano said. "I hear she's the best in the business and the best in the business deserves to be with other bests in the business."

Meanwhile, Kail's journey has just taken another interesting turn.

"It's been a pretty good trip. I met a lot of people along the way. Not very many people can say they go to work and talk to their friends all day," she said.
